There's no need to be worried about idol actors. What I wrote below REALLY applies to your comment (although it's a copy paste from my other replies)
-It's a good thing that real idols are acting, since this drama is literally about idols lives and the kpop industry. Wouldn’t the acting feel more real since the idols themselves have been in that environment? I mean, the idols themselves (specifically Yunho from Ateez) have said in an interview how much they relate with their characters. Yunho is exactly like his character Yoojin, they both had the same trainee experience and goals in life. Their personalities are also identical. That role fits him specifically because of his idol experience. -----We even get to see the behind the scenes of the kpop world! I’m sure it's exciting for the idols actors who sing and perform not only in their own groups, but in a drama. It’s also interesting for viewers (especially kpop fans & kdrama fans) to see how the kpop industry works, rumours, scandals, mental health, secret relationships, debuting, disbanding and etc.
-Also, I have seen and heard many people be weary about inexperienced actors, especially if they have no previous acting experience. I feel like the only thing to do is wait to see their potential. These actors go through tough auditions and are specifically chosen when they meet the requirements. Although they might have less acting experience, they can use this opportunity to develop their acting skills. (Take Cha Eunwoo for example. He began as an idol with no acting experience. Once he landed his first acting role, although it wasn't the best, he kept getting more roles that fit him and he is constantly developing his skills. With the help of his seniors and the fans, he will only grow to be a fully experienced actor soon.) This same patience we had for Cha Eunwoo is what we should have for these new actors in 'Imitation'. -----In many behind the scene videos, the ‘Imitation’ rookie actors have said that, they feel honoured to be able to work with their seniors and the experienced actors. The seniors are Ahn Danny, Jo Jungchi, Shim Eunjin and Jiyeon. The experienced actors are Lee Junyoung, Chani and Oh Heejoon. Both the seniors and experienced actors will definitely help and support all the inexperienced actors.
Overall, know that almost everyone in that cast list has acting abilities and experience. It might not be shown officially here, but just know that they’ve done thousand of shows and dramas within their kpop work!

La Lima ends up with no one. In the webtoon, Hyuk had a crush on her but since he was too young, she shut him down. Also, she has a crush on KwonRyuk but after seeing his and Maha's relationship, she decides to stop liking her.

On netflix it's converted as 20 episodes (each 1 hour long) and I'm 9 episodes in, half way done. So far, it's focuses mainly on historical (especially about women in Joseon era) and comedy. There's little political scenes but that's not the main focus.
p.s. the historical aspects might be confusing and hard to understand. However, the comedy scenes make up for it and is a little bit easier to digest.
At first i'm not gonna lie, it was boring because of the constant slow scenes of them just staring around or thinking. But after a few more episodes and truly understanding the characters, I realized that the topics in this drama feel realistic. Those slow scenes are now what I enjoy the most lol.
